首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Jenkins服务在系统更新后不再启动

Jenkins服务是一个开源的持续集成和交付工具,用于自动化构建、测试和部署软件项目。它提供了一个易于使用的Web界面,可以通过插件扩展其功能。

当系统更新后,Jenkins服务不再启动可能是由于以下原因:

  1. 依赖项冲突:系统更新可能导致Jenkins所依赖的某些软件包或库发生冲突,从而导致服务无法启动。解决方法是检查依赖项,并确保它们与系统更新兼容。
  2. 配置文件更改:系统更新可能导致Jenkins的配置文件发生更改,从而导致服务无法正确加载配置。解决方法是检查配置文件的更改,并相应地更新Jenkins的配置。
  3. 端口冲突:系统更新可能导致Jenkins所使用的端口被其他服务占用,从而导致服务无法启动。解决方法是检查端口占用情况,并将Jenkins配置为使用其他可用端口。
  4. 系统权限问题:系统更新可能导致Jenkins所需的权限发生变化,从而导致服务无法以所需的权限运行。解决方法是检查Jenkins所需的权限,并确保系统配置正确。

针对以上问题,可以尝试以下解决方案:

  1. 检查系统更新的日志和错误信息,查找可能导致Jenkins服务无法启动的具体原因。
  2. 检查Jenkins的日志文件,通常位于Jenkins的安装目录下的logs文件夹中,查找任何与系统更新相关的错误或警告信息。
  3. 确保系统中的所有依赖项都已正确安装,并且与系统更新兼容。
  4. 检查Jenkins的配置文件,确保其与系统更新后的配置文件一致。
  5. 检查系统中的端口占用情况,确保Jenkins所需的端口未被其他服务占用。
  6. 确保Jenkins所需的权限已正确配置,并且与系统更新后的权限设置一致。

如果问题仍然存在,可以尝试重新安装Jenkins或联系Jenkins的支持团队寻求进一步的帮助。

腾讯云提供了一系列与Jenkins相关的产品和服务,例如:

  1. 云服务器(CVM):提供可靠的云服务器实例,可以用于安装和运行Jenkins服务。了解更多:云服务器产品介绍
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,可以用于存储Jenkins的配置和数据。了解更多:云数据库MySQL版产品介绍
  3. 云监控(Cloud Monitor):提供实时监控和告警功能,可以监控Jenkins服务的运行状态和性能指标。了解更多:云监控产品介绍

请注意,以上仅为示例,具体的产品选择应根据实际需求和情况进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

视频直播系统用户信息更新私信服务该如何进行资料更新

视频直播系统一定会用到推送功能,对于视频直播软件开发而言,比较简便的私信功能实现方式就是借助于三方服务商提供的SDK。有时我们直播平台运营过程中,会遇到这样一个问题。...用户修改了昵称、头像等个人资料信息,正常情况下这些信息只会在运营方的数据库更新,而像推送功能服务商那里的服务器并不会同步更新,这就会出现推送的消息中显示的用户信息资料还是原来的。...极光推送可以实现视频直播系统中的推送和私信功能,更新用户信息资料极光推送服务器端进行资料更新,操作还是比较简单的。...以用户头像为例,基本操作步骤如下: 1、准备更新上传的用户头像图片,格式为:png,jpg或jpeg 2、将要更新的图片上传保存在系统所处的服务器指定目录下 3、引用极光SDK等相关信息,将存在已知目录中的图片上传到极光...如果您在实际的直播平台运营过程中,也使用了极光推送服务,可以参考此文档实现用户数据的更新。如果您使用了其他家的推送服务,具体的更新操作流程会有差异,请以服务商给予的操作指导为准!

1K30
  • Tomcat 服务:解决 Apache Tomcat 更新 Tomcat9w.exe 无法启动 Tomcat 服务的问题

    解决 Tomcat9w.exe 无法启动 Tomcat 服务的问题/解决 Apache Tomcat 更新 Apache Tomcat 9.0 Tomcat9 Properties 配置不匹配的问题...文章目录 解决 Tomcat9w.exe 无法启动 Tomcat 服务的问题/解决 Apache Tomcat 更新 Apache Tomcat 9.0 Tomcat9 Properties 配置不匹配的问题...无法启动 Tomcat 服务的问题(Tomcat 页面报 404 错误) 6.1、重装系统的 Tomcat service 服务 6.2、打开 Tomcat9w.exe 查看最新的配置信息 6.3、重启...,这里不再赘述。...6.1、重装系统的 Tomcat service 服务 DOS 命令行,输入 service.bat remove 移除之前旧版本的配置信息,具体如下图所示: 输入 service.bat install

    1.7K30

    EasyDSS Windows下以服务启动失败不会重启的问题优化

    对于TSINGSEE青犀视频平台,如果碰到启动失败的问题,我们理想的情况是设定重启机制,但是EasyDSS Windows 系统下,服务运行失败并不会自动重启。...因为和系统相关,代码中暂时无法实现该功能,因此只能通过脚本的方式设置,设置完毕即可。...我们可以脚本文件中增加以下代码: :: 设置服务失败,3秒钟重新运行 sc failure "TsingseeMediaServer" reset= 0 actions= restart/3000...设置以上,恢复选项即正确。...此外,EasyDSS的使用场景非常丰富,更新之后的版本也越来越符合现代技术的趋势和用户的使用需求,除了在线教育、端视频点播方面的应用之外,还可以拓展到物联网、物流仓储、移动监控等多个方面,欢迎大家了解和测试

    1.3K20

    PM2让Node.js项目服务器崩溃重启,能自启动

    一、问题简介 当服务器意外崩溃重启,Node.js要能够自启动,恢复服务。...二、解决方案 1、三步完成 # 1、创建启动脚本 pm2 startup # 2、上面命令会输出类似如下提示,按照提示执行 [PM2] You have to run this command as.../versions/node/v14.3/bin pm2 startup -u --hp # 3、保存正在运行的应用到启动脚本...pm2 save # 现在可以重启服务器,看看 node.js 项目是否能自启动 2、其他 # 恢复上一次保存的自启动列表 pm2 resurrect # 取消自启动 pm2 unstartup...# 当 node.js 版本更新时,请一定要卸载并新建 自启动脚本 pm2 unstartup pm2 startup 三、参考文档 PM2让Node.js项目服务器崩溃重启,能自启动

    1.7K10

    本地计算机上的MySQL服务启动停止。某些服务未由其他服务或程序使用时将自动停止

    1、其中一个是:Windows无法启动MySQL57服务(位于本地计算机上)错误1067:进程意外终止,报错如下图所示。 ? 2、紧跟着还有一个报错:本地计算机上的MySQL服务启动停止。...某些服务未由其他服务或程序使用时将自动停止,报错如下图所示。 ? 3、之后即便我垂死挣扎,命令行窗口中不断的重启MySQL服务,但是仍然没有戳到痛点,尝试的步骤有下图为证。 ?...5、后来也想过直接通过点击“我的电脑>管理>服务>MySQL”,收到启动MySQL,但是丝毫没有改观。 ? 6、经过一番尝试之后,还是行不通。...首先务必使用管理员权限进入到命令行、务必使用管理员权限进入到命令行、务必使用管理员权限进入到命令行,重要的事情说三遍,不然的话就会出现“发生系统错误 5。 拒绝访问。”这样的错误,如下图所示。 ?...之后就可以看到MySQL服务顺利启动。 而且状态栏的MySQL Notifier中也会弹出提示,如下图所示,MySQL的状态变为从停止变为启动。 ?

    62.8K2616

    CentOS上安装Nginx配置HTTPS并设置系统服务和开机启动(最全教程)

    image.png 第六步:配置为系统服务 1、系统服务目录里创建 nginx.service 文件。...为重启命令 ExecStop 为停止命令 PrivateTmp=True 表示给服务分配独立的临时空间 [Install] 运行级别下服务安装的相关设置,可设置为多用户,即系统运行级别为3 注意:...daemon-reload 3、杀死 nginx 重启nginx pkill -9 nginx systemctl restart nginx ps aux | grep nginx image.png 说明配置系统服务成功...# 查看所有已启动服务 systemctl list-units --type=service 致谢及彩蛋 这篇文章写了整整两天,希望能为你带来帮助。...彩蛋 :写这篇文章之前,我的域名开了CDN加速,原本我的nginx是配置好的,我更新了我的网站程序,怎么刷新内容都不变,我还以为我的nginx出错了,而且考虑到我的服务器好长时间没有清理了,直接TMD

    2K30

    Win11系统,为了右键菜单返回Win10样式用了StartAllBack系统更新导致explorer闪屏

    问题:Win11系统,StartAllBack系统更新导致explorer闪屏 系统更新出现了这个界面,然后StartAllBack就和explorer冲突了,一直闪屏 解决方案:发送Ctrl...4307-9B53-224DE2ED1FE6}" /v System.IsPinnedToNameSpaceTree /t REG_DWORD /d 1 /f 禁止Edge和Chrome浏览器相关开机服务...Get-ScheduledTask | Where-Object { $_.TaskName -like "OneDrive*"}| Disable-ScheduledTask 2>$null 禁止硬件比如显卡自动更新驱动...H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Policies\System" /v EnableLUA /t REG_DWORD /d 1 /f PC系统建议执行下这句命令...,要不然系统容易自动锁定 cmd net accounts /lockoutthreshold:0 powershell cmd.exe /c "net accounts /lockoutthreshold

    1.5K30

    【错误解决】本地计算机上的mysql服务启动停止,某些服务未由其他服务或程序使用时将自动停止

    转载请注明出处:http://blog.csdn.net/qq_26525215 本文源自【大学之旅_谙忆的博客】 欢迎点击访问我的瞎几把整站点:复制未来 启动mysql服务时出现该错误:...本地计算机上的mysql服务启动停止,某些服务未由其他服务或程序使用时将自动停止。...mysql 版本 5.7.14 系统 win 7 后来经过一系列的百度,谷歌,总算是解决了。 首先,你需要把原来的服务删除: mysqld --remove mysql ?...注意:mysql为你的服务名称,自己可以随便定义的。 此命令需要进入mysql安装目录下的bin目录运行! mysql的根目录下: 你需要清空data目录。...然后bin目录

    2.3K41

    工程化能力必备技能,前端 jenkins 自动化部署持续集成

    当需要更新测试环境版本时,测试同事需要手动操作以下过程。 连接打包服务器 打开svn管理工具,找到目标svn版本号并拉取项目 拉取项目,打开命令行,下载依赖。 等待依赖下载结束。.../jenkins Jenkins初始化 成功启动容器,访问Jenkins服务器IP地址加端口号,进行Jenkins初始化,初始化的管理员密码从日志中可以获取。...构建结束将 dist 文件夹的内容压缩成压缩包:"dist.tar.gz" 配置构建操作 在前端资源打包完成,我们需要将文件送到目标服务器。此处添加送往的目标服务器。...Jenkins就会按照SVN地址拉取代码,并且执行构建命令,构建完成将dist文件夹压缩成压缩包,送到目标服务器并且执行预留在目标服务器的批处理文件。...不再需要为打包的事情苦恼,一切都变得这么简单。 感谢TL一直的信任和支持,我提出有这样的想法时,不断的帮我争取借用到各个生产服务器环境的权限。也让我领悟到,只有不断跳出固定领域。

    1.5K11

    Windows 安装程序更新

    Jenkins 的 Windows 安装程序已经存在很多年了,它是用户 Windows 上安装 Jenkins Master 作为服务的一种方式。...用户不能选择 Jenkins 作为 Windows 服务启动时的端口以及账户。 安装程序捆绑了32位的 Java Runtime,而没有使用已存在的 JRE。...用户能够为服务输入用户信息,同时选择端口以便于 Jenkins 验证端口是否可用。 安装程序不再捆绑 JRE 而是操作系统中寻找合适的 JRE。...JENKINS_HOME 目录被放置启动服务用户的 LocalAppData 目录下,这与现代 Windows 文件系统布局一致。...安装程序现在不再捆绑 JRE,而是系统上搜索兼容的 JRE (现在是 JRE 8)。 如果你想使用与安装程序搜索到不同的 JRE,你可以浏览目录并指定它。

    1.8K20

    通过Jenkins持续构建flask项目

    上一篇介绍了如何把flask项目部署到服务器 但是有个明显的缺点:每次代码更新都得重新打包上传到服务器,比较繁琐 所以还是老套路啊,借助Jenkins和Gitee来实现代码的自动部署,幸运的是几年前写过关于...Jenkins使用的学习博客 参考之前的写的文章,很顺利地借助Jenkins把flask项目部署好了 整体步骤如下 1、服务器中部署Jenkins 因为我们要使用Jenkins来完成持续化构建...,所以需要在服务器上先部署一个Jerkins服务Jenkins官网下载了一个war包,然后借助tomcat部署好了,具体步骤可以百度下,网上教程很多,这里不再赘述 2、jenkins中安装必要插件...之从0到1利用Git和Ant插件打war包并自动部署到tomcat(第二话):安装插件,配置JDK、Git、Ant 4、Jenkins中添加shell命令 拉取代码,还需要设置Jenkins,让它执行...中,拉取项目代码执行启动命令,需要在【构建环境】中添加shell命令,如下 构建一次,打开这个构建任务的控制台输出,如下,项目已经正常启动了 ---- 为了试验一下git代码更新,有没有拉取新的代码

    83820

    自动化持续集成环境搭建(上):git + maven + jenkins

    maven插件和git插件安装jenkins的时候已经自动安装好了 maven插件 ? git插件 ? jenkins全局工具配置 系统管理→全局工具配置 git ? maven ? ?...如果是ssh方式,Private Key填写Jenkins主机的root用户私钥(/root/.ssh/id_rsa),用户是启动tomcat服务的用户,我是用root安装、启动的 ?...05 触发构建项目 _____ 上面,是我们手动点击构建jenkins去gitee拉取的代码,这一小节,演示触发构建,即开发提交代码就自动化拉取代码、构建。。。...填入上面jenkins中的url和密码 ? 上面点击【添加】,点击下方【测试】 ? 可以看到,jenkins自动构建了 ? 构建成功 ? 服务启动起来了 ? 浏览器访问成功 ?...代码仓库可以看到更新 ? ? jenkins自动构建 ? 服务启动了 ? url访问,可以看到部门变成了“持续集成部” ?

    1.9K20

    jenkins持续集成环境从0到1搭建全过程

    1.jenkins官网下载地址:https://jenkins.io/download/ 目前稳定版本: 2.204.2 jenkins项目有两条发布线,分别是LTS长期支持版(或稳定版)和每周更新版...2.下载jdk1.8以上版本并安装,安装配置jdk的环境变量。(这里不再累述具体步骤) 二、jenkins安装安装方式一: 1.Dos窗口中切换到"jenkins.war"目录。...打开Tomcat下bin目录的startup.bat启动tomcat服务。...(这里不再累述具体步骤) 启动时发现dos窗口中有很多乱码,不影响运行,但是看着总是不舒服,解决方案如下: 我们来到tomcat目录的conf子目录中,找到一个名为"logging.properties...文件出现:jenkins is fully up and runing说明启动成功jenkins了。

    35810

    WSL2 Ubuntu 20.04 LTS 环境下安装Jenkins

    为了使我们上面配置的生效,就需要进行更新apt。执行命令为:apt-get update 。 更新系统回显中,就会出现我们刚才配置的服务器地址了。...(网络问题)例如: 更新成功执行install jenkins的时候网络不稳定还是会频繁出现超时等网络问题的。 如果出现上面所示的就代表更新完毕了。...我们就可以执行下一步,下载jenkins了。 第五步:下载并安装jenkinsapt更新完毕,我们就可以直接执行apt-getinstall jenkins 进行安装操作了。...安装完毕,我们就要开始启动jenkins了。 配置完毕的相关信息: jenkins将会被设置为开机启动的守护进程。...启动 Jenkins 在前面的配置完毕,就可以执行systemctl start jenkins。进行启动jenkins了。后续的就是通过 本地域名:8080 进行访问控制了。

    65830

    Jenkins 版本更新历史

    防止更新中心进行数据解析时 Jenkins 页面卡住。 Winstone 5.7: 修复对系统日志记录定制的支持 (由 2.177 引入的缺陷回归)。...修复代理脱机时代理 API 中的空指针异常(例如查询代理版本或操作系统说明)。 v2.204.2 (2020-01-29) 验证另一个用户时,当前用户不再注销。...如果没有连接更新站点,Jenkins不再通知可用更新。在这种情况下,建议使用更新站点的本地镜像,或使用 Juseppe 之类的自托管更新中心。 允许按用户设置时区。...为资源根 URL 添加一个选项,Jenkins 可以通过该选项为用户生成的静态资源(例如工作空间文件或已归档的制品)提供服务,而无需 Content-Security-Policy 标头。...当分离的插件(其插件功能曾经是 Jenkins 本身的一部分)作为已经存在的其他插件的隐含依赖时,确保 Jenkins 启动时对其进行安装。

    3.5K30
    领券